Fairtrade in Hofkirchen

I was reading an article the other day in the printed version of OÖ Nachrichten. This article talks about Hofkirchen, a small town in Upper Austria, which becomes a “Fairtrade-Municipality”.

I thought you might be interested because it is a current topic which concerns social responsibility. Fairtrade is a label which guarantees that products are produced under fair circumstances and are sold at fair prices.

Basically what the article says is that the municipality’s goal is to make its citizens buy more fair trade products.

It also says that the municipality’s representatives drink fair trade coffee during proceedings and meetings

What surprised me most was that a small municipality like Hofkirchen is going to buy expensive Fairtrade products in these times where municipalities have to save money.


I personally think that is a good idea to pay Fairtrade products. These products assure not only high quality and fair products they also ban child labour. I hope that Hofkirchen is a model for many other municipalities.
